That is because, though ΖΩΗ is supposed to be partially (ok, largely) borderline ridiculous fun, it will also have a certain footballing depth that you surely are not expecting, provided by player attributes which are not entirely random or invented, but rather have the support of a unique concept. Here’s the deal: Each player’s skillset will be a kind of translation of his/her historical relevance. Take Plato for example: considering he was one of the greatest thinkers in the history of the world, he will be depicted in ΖΩΗ as a centreback with one of the highest Defense and mental stats in ΖΩΗ: his real philosophical brilliance therefore translated as the rock-solid legendary defender he will be in this game. On the other hand, a legendary conqueror such as Alexander the Great will be, you guessed it, one of the best strikers of ΖΩΗ – alongside the world’s greatest warriors and conquerors, who shall be one of the most offensively dangerous individuals in the game, from Attila the Hun to Julius Caesar.

Of course, even with such a concept as a platform, one will still have to get very creative here: how much Short Pass Speed should Vasco da Gama have? Should Napoleon have a Scoring special skill? Admittedly I will have to invent a lot, even if it is possible to, say, reproduce Donald Trump as a high Balance, low Speed and Agility footballer because of his out-of-shape body, or Woody Allen as a talented but physically frail footballer because, well, of his physical appearance. I imagine, for example, actor John Wayne as a potent CB, though not exactly the most defensively talented, but, again, looking at his physical profile, as well as his typical “movie persona” he cultivated during his career as a rather stoic, no-nonsense, old-fashioned man, I “translate it” to a footballing persona similar to that of a no-nonsense CB (ML Defaults Vornander is a great example, so is Gentile, Tony Adams, Jorge Costa, etc.). A talented artist/inventor will have high Technical stats, great explorers shall have top stamina, etc. Then, as soon as I get the pillars of a “footballing profile” for a specific player, with a bit of creativity, the final “avatar” should be ready.

Then, it’s not enough to get that accurate footballing “translation”: players will have to have realistic differences between them. For example, Karl Marx is one of the most influential thinkers in history, so probably he will have a phenomenal Defense attribute, but Plato will just have to have more. Sir Francis Drake was a legendary explorer, but will he have more Stamina than the G.O.A.T Marco Polo? Of course not. As you can see, ΖΩΗ becomes an even more monumental project. I know some history but I will need to read a hell of a lot more to be able to build this database – and, surely, I will need help.
